    I purchased a Samsung SH-S202N 20X DVD writer with Lightscribe, installed it no problems, and installed drivers from Lightscribe.com.

    I am using Nero 8 as my burning software, and also for my Lightscribe labeling, I am using Datasafe Lightscribe 16X (v1.2) DVD-R disks for all my burning.

    The problem I am having is:

    I can only burn one disk and one label then my pc locks its self solid if I try to burn a second label or disk, all I can hear is the DVD drive spinning and I cant stop it or open the door it locks solid.

    So I have to burn a disk and reboot, burn a label and reboot etc, etc.

    Has anyone else had any problems like this?? if so how do I fix it please??

    A couple of other things to check.
    Could be a virus, or trojan. Do a scan of your drives.
    Might be heat buildup. See if your pc is overheating. Try placing it near a fan, or you can get these laptop cooler things that seem to be a fan your laptop sits on.
    Driver conflicts as already stated.
    It sounds like the program takes over the drives, and is not going to give up the disc until its ready to release it. Just make sure its really finished before attempting another label. With my old lightscribe drives and software, sometimes it would look like it was finished, but the thing was still doing something for a few minutes.

    It sounds like the lightscribe software is hanging instead of exiting cleanly.

    Bring up task manager when everything seems to have frozen and make sure the process has actually exited. Task manager should still start even if a process has stalled.. if it refuses then you need to check for malware, specifically the win32 family.
